The Mazda repair market in Sealy, Texas, is characteristic of a smaller, semi-rural city. There are no dedicated, Mazda-exclusive dealerships or performance shops within the city limits. The market is served primarily by independent auto repair centers that handle a wide range of domestic and Japanese vehicles. The overall average quality is good, with several shops boasting strong local reputations built over decades. **Competition Level:** Moderate. The market is not saturated with specialists, which means the top-rated shops are consistently busy. Customers seeking basic maintenance have several good options, but those requiring advanced, model-specific expertise for systems like i-ACTIV AWD or Mazda Connect may find their choices limited to 1-2 top-tier providers, like Sealy Automotive & Performance. **Typical Pricing:** Labor rates in Sealy are generally more affordable than in nearby metropolitan areas like Houston or Austin. Expect to pay between **$95 - $125 per hour** for labor. This is below the urban average, providing good value for the level of expertise available, especially for complex diagnostics and repair work on modern Mazdas. Parts pricing will vary but is typically competitive through local networks like NAPA.
